Since 90% of all computers are t present in the Industrial world, mostly in the United States, the language of the Internet is almost entirely English, even though this language is spoken by only 10% of the world population. The benefits at the Information technology are therefore almost exclusively available to the English speaking industrialized nations, resulting in the less developed countries tailing back very rapidly in technological attainment.
